回答編集履歴
2
コメントの追加
test
CHANGED
@@ -2,7 +2,7 @@
|
|
2
2
|
|
3
3
|
もし公開鍵暗号アルゴリズムがRSAであれば、秘密鍵暗号の秘密鍵をA社からB社に送信するためには、データを暗号化した秘密鍵暗号の鍵をRSAで暗号化して暗号文と一緒に送る必要があります。
|
4
4
|
|
5
|
-
これとは別に、
|
5
|
+
これとは別に、ディフィー・ヘルマン鍵交換という方法もあるのですが、これは秘密鍵暗号の秘密鍵をA社とB社が同じ鍵を共有するために使います。
|
6
6
|
|
7
7
|
よって、まず秘密鍵暗号の方式と公開鍵暗号の方式を決める必要があります。
|
8
8
|
|
1
コメントの追加
test
CHANGED
@@ -19,3 +19,7 @@
|
|
19
19
|
RSAの秘密鍵というのは、2つの巨大素数であり、秘密鍵暗号(AESなど)の鍵はランダムに選んだビット列です。つまり秘密鍵暗号の鍵は素数ではありません。
|
20
20
|
|
21
21
|
RSAの場合、秘密鍵というのは復号鍵であり、暗号化のために使う公開鍵と分離して秘密に保持しておく必要があります。
|
22
|
+
|
23
|
+
|
24
|
+
|
25
|
+
もし、2社が頻繁に暗号化通信を必要とする場合拠点間VPNなどの解決法もあるので検討してみてください。
|